About this program
The Workforce Innovation and Opportunity Act (WIOA) Youth Program Allotments for Program Year 2026 provides funding to support programs that assist youth in gaining the skills and experience necessary for successful employment. This grant is designed for organizations that work with young people, particularly those facing barriers to employment. Through this program, eligible entities can implement initiatives that enhance job readiness, provide training, and connect youth with career opportunities. The program targets youth aged 14 to 24, focusing on those who are out of school or at risk of dropping out. Organizations that receive funding will be expected to create comprehensive strategies that include mentoring, work experience, and educational support. By fostering partnerships with local businesses and educational institutions, the WIOA Youth Program aims to create a pathway for youth to enter the workforce and achieve economic self-sufficiency.
Eligibility
Eligible entities include local workforce development boards, educational institutions, and nonprofit organizations that serve youth.
